Analysis

In 2025, sdrs holdings, sdr in Sudan stood at 768.82 million.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.1% on the previous year and up 514.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sdrs holdings, sdr in Sudan peaked at 772.00 million in 2021 and was at its lowest, 0, in 1945.

Sudan ranks 64th of 196 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
